In the next few months, E-mail spam is going to get a lot worse, at least, that’s the prediction of The SpamHaus project, a global anti-spam group that point the finger to a new spamming technique that consist of sending spam via the ISPs (Internet Service Providers) directly, instead of using individual machines.

It makes it impossible to block E-mails coming from the ISP’s internet address without also blocking millions of legitimate E-mails.

And that comes right after AOL claimed that spam was going down and that everybody was saying that spammers had given up… It seems that spammers have adapted. How can they use the ISP’s infrastructure and why can’t the ISPs prevent them from doing it?
